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
476149 7631 52226 72853153313 3205018
01386 423768 385919499
01386 423768 385919499
54548 1109126 299
All about undefined
Interested in learning more?
01386 423768 385919499
54548 1109126 299
See more
59650 37 1200
00319626 35 59
See more
15832 017019785
82 4518152085 9007 442
See more